Satake classification
The spherical Hecke algebra acts on through a character. The normalized Satake isomorphism turns this character into the Satake parameter of , a semisimple conjugacy class in the appropriate Frobenius coset of the -group.
Choice and terminology
The adjective depends on the chosen integral model, hence on , although hyperspecial subgroups are suitably conjugate in the standard unramified setting. “Spherical representation” is also used more broadly for any representation with fixed vectors under a chosen maximal compact subgroup; the present definition is specifically nonarchimedean and hyperspecial.
